Imagine a circle with a radius of 1. That's the unit circle! It's a powerful tool for understanding trigonometric functions beyond just right-angled triangles. The x and y coordinates of points on the unit circle correspond to the cosine and sine of the angle formed with the x-axis, respectively. Interesting Fact: The word "sine" comes from a mistranslation! The original Sanskrit word was "jiva," which meant "bowstring." When the Arabs translated it, they wrote "jiba," which sounds similar to the Arabic word "jaib" meaning "bay" or "pocket." When Europeans translated it into Latin, they used "sinus," which means "bay" or "curve." So, "sine" is a mathematical term born from a series of translation errors!
History: Hipparchus, a Greek astronomer and mathematician, is often considered the "father of trigonometry." He created a table of chords, which was a precursor to our modern sine tables.

The foundation of trigonometry lies in right-angled triangles. Remember that the hypotenuse is always the longest side and is opposite the right angle. The other two sides are the opposite and adjacent sides, defined relative to the angle you're considering.
These angles are crucial in many real-world problems. The angle of elevation is the angle from the horizontal upwards to a point of interest (like looking up at the top of a building). The angle of depression is the angle from the horizontal downwards to a point of interest (like looking down at a boat from a cliff). Visualizing these with diagrams is key! Bearings are used to specify directions. They are measured clockwise from North. For example, a bearing of 090° means East, 180° means South, and 270° means West. Understanding bearings is essential for navigation problems.

Imagine you're standing a certain distance away from a tall building. You can measure the angle of elevation to the top of the building using a clinometer (or even a smartphone app!). Knowing the distance to the building and the angle of elevation, you can use the tangent function to calculate the height of the building. This is a classic trigonometry problem!
A ship sails 10 km on a bearing of 045° and then 15 km on a bearing of 135°. How far is the ship from its starting point? This problem involves using trigonometry to break down the distances into North-South and East-West components, then using the Pythagorean theorem to find the resultant distance. The Sine Rule is your go-to formula when you have certain combinations of sides and angles in a triangle. It states that the ratio of a side length to the sine of its opposite angle is constant for all sides and angles in the triangle.
The Sine Rule can be written as:
a / sin(A) = b / sin(B) = c / sin(C)

The Cosine Rule is another essential tool for solving non-right-angled triangles. It relates the lengths of all three sides of a triangle to the cosine of one of its angles.
The Cosine Rule has a few variations, depending on which angle you're working with:

Interesting Fact: The Cosine Rule is actually a generalization of the Pythagorean theorem! If angle C is 90°, then cos(C) = 0, and the Cosine Rule simplifies to c² = a² + b².

This formula is a lifesaver when you *don't* have the height of the triangle. It states that the area of any triangle is half the product of two sides and the sine of the included angle.
